FOLLOW THESE STEPS WHEN BATTERY 
17. 
IS OUTSIDE VEHICLE. A SPARK NEAR 
BATTERY MAY CAUSE BATTERY 
EXPLOSION. TO REDUCE RISK OF 
A SPARK NEAR BATTERY:
a) 
Check polarity of battery terminals. POSITIVE (POS, P, +) battery post usually has 
a larger diameter than NEGATIVE (NEG, N, -) post.
b) 
Attach at least a 24-inch-long 6-gauge (AWG) insulated battery cable to 
NEGATIVE (NEG, N, -) battery post.
c) 
Connect POSITIVE (RED) charger clip to POSITIVE (POS, P, +) battery of post. 
d) 
Position yourself and free end of cable as far away from battery as possible – then 
connect NEGATIVE (BLACK) charger clip to free end of cable.
e) 
Do not face the battery when making the final connection.
f) 
When disconnecting charger, always do so in reverse sequence of connecting 
procedure and break first connection while as far away from battery as practical.
g) 
When disconnecting charger, disconnect in reverse sequence from connecting 
procedure. See operating instructions for charge information.
h) 
A marine (boat) battery must be removed and charged on shore. To charge it on 
board requires equipment specially designed for marine use.
The battery charger must be connected to the battery according to
the instructions above.

IMPORTANT SAFETY INFORMATION!

The MULTI US 25000 cannot be used to restore a fully worn out battery.
If the MULTI US 25000 does not switch to maintenance charge after three days (green 
light illuminated), there is a fault. Possible causes: 
•  The battery is probably worn out and should be replaced. 
•  Some large antimony batteries may behave different and can allow the 
MULTI US 25000 to charge the battery for too long, which can lead to overcharging. 
See caution!
•  If heavy power consumers like fitted alarms and navigation computers are connected to 
the battery, the charging process takes longer and this can also overcharge the battery. 
•  A sulphated battery will only accept current with difficulty, and consequently the charg-
ing process takes a particularly long time. A worn out battery cannot be fully charged. 
Therefore you should always check whether the charger has been switched to mainte-
nance charge before you leave it turned on or unobserved for longer periods.
